
Basil Brush has been a familiar figure on British children's television for many years. The fox-shaped glove puppet was performed and voiced by Ivan Owen until his death in 2000. He starred in his own long-running series, The Basil Brush Show, which debuted in 1968 and attracted a broad family audience by mixing children’s entertainment with occasional topical humor. The program continued for twelve years before reportedly being cancelled after the BBC declined to reschedule it to a later time slot. Basil later appeared on ITV in the educational children’s program Let's Read with Basil Brush, and subsequently returned to the BBC as a guest host on Crackerjack!. A new version of The Basil Brush Show premiered in 2002, this time aimed more directly at children than at family audiences, with Basil voiced by Michael Winsor. Owing to his long-standing popularity on British television, Basil also made cameo appearances in other programs, including as part of a puppet government in The Goodies episode “Special: Goodies Rule OK?” (1975).
